RDL8-40 Series (RCBO) Residual Current Operated Cicuit Breaker With Integral Overcurrent Protection


(MENAFN- GetNews) Product description:

RDL8-40 residual current circuit breaker with over-current protection is applicable to a circuit of AC50/60Hz, 230V (single phase), for overload, short circuit and residual current protection.

Electromagnetic type RCD current up to 40A. It is mainly used in domestic installation, as well as in commercial and industrial electrical distribution systems conforms with the standard of IEC/ EN61009.



Main features:

1. Supports all types of residual current protection: AC, A2. Multiple breaking capacities for residential and industrial applications3. Rated current up to 40A with user-defined poles for single-phase or three-phase grids4. Rated residual current: 30mA, 100mA, 300mA

The role of RCBO:

Residual current operated circuit breakers (RCBO) with overcurrent protection are mainly suitable for applications requiring both overcurrent protection (overload and short circuit) and earth fault current protection. It can detect faults and trip in time to ensure the safety of staff and equipment.



Technical specifications:

Standard IEC/EN 61009
Type (wave form of the earth leakage sensed) AC, A
Thermo-magnetic release characteristic B, C
Rated current In A 6, 10, 16, 20, 25, 32, 40
Poles 1P+N, 3P+N
Rated voltage Ue V 230/ 400-240/ 415
Rated sensitivity I△n A 0.03, 0.1, 0.3
Rated short-circuit capacity Icn A 6000
Break time under I△n s ≤0.1
Electrical life 4000 times
Mechanical life 4000 times
Mounting On DIN rail EN60715(35mm)by means of fast clip device
Terminal connection type Cable/ pin type busbar/ U type busbar
